What is the definition of the Laws of Exponents?
Back
The Laws of Exponents are rules that describe how to handle mathematical operations involving powers or exponents.

What is the value of any non-zero number raised to the power of 0?
Back
1

Simplify: x^a * x^b
Back
x^(a+b) (Product of Powers Rule)

Simplify: x^a / x^b
Back
x^(a-b) (Quotient of Powers Rule)

Simplify: (x^a)^b
Back
x^(a*b) (Power of a Power Rule)

What is the value of x^0?
Back
1, for any non-zero x.

Simplify: (xy)^a
Back
x^a * y^a (Power of a Product Rule)
